Overview
Infant Jesus Anglo-Indian Higher Secondary School (IJHSS) is a long-standing ICSE/ISC school known for its academic discipline, experienced teachers, and active co-curricular life. It’s a well-recognized name in Kollam with a strong heritage and visible board results.
